The postcode NE42 6PU is located in Northumberland It was introduced in January 1980 and is an active postcode. NE42 6PU is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).

NE42 6PU is one of the less de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 7.1 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of NE42 6PU as Suburbanites > Semi-detached suburbia > Older workers and retirement.

The closest road name to NE42 6PU is Maple Grove which is centered 18 m away.

The nearest bus stop is Sycamore Grove and is 139 m away. The closest railway station is Prudhoe Station, 528 m away.

The closest primary school to NE42 6PU (for ages 11 and under) is St Matthew's Catholic Primary School. It achieved an OFSTED rating of Good on July 17, 2018.

The local pub for residents of NE42 6PU is Halfway House Inn and is 408 m away. The Food Standards Agency (FSA) rated it as AwaitingInspection . The nearest takeaway food is available from Big Licks Ice Cream Parlour and is 473 m distant. The FSA rated this establishment as Good on June 10, 2021.

Residents reported an average download speed of 61.6 Mbps and an average upload speed of 15 Mbps in a 2017 OFCOM broadband survey. 24% of residents have broadband access of ultrafast 300+ Mbps. 100% of residents have broadband access of superfast 30-300 Mbps.

Gas consumption for the area is rated at 2.4 out of 10. Electricity consumption for the area is rated at 0.3 out of 10. Where 0 are the lowest and 10 are the highest consuming areas in the country respectively.

Policing for NE42 6PU is covered by the Northumbria police force association and Northumberland is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
